Package org.quartz.spi
Class TriggerFiredBundle
- java.lang.Object
-
- org.quartz.spi.TriggerFiredBundle
-
- All Implemented Interfaces:
java.io.Serializable
public class TriggerFiredBundle extends java.lang.Object implements java.io.Serializable
A simple class (structure) used for returning execution-time data from the JobStore to the
QuartzSchedulerThread
.- Author:
- James House
- See Also:
QuartzSchedulerThread
, Serialized Form
-
-
Constructor Summary
Constructors Constructor Description TriggerFiredBundle(JobDetail job, OperableTrigger trigger, Calendar cal, boolean jobIsRecovering, java.util.Date fireTime, java.util.Date scheduledFireTime, java.util.Date prevFireTime, java.util.Date nextFireTime)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Calendar
getCalendar()
java.util.Date
getFireTime()
JobDetail
getJobDetail()
java.util.Date
getNextFireTime()
java.util.Date
getPrevFireTime()
java.util.Date
getScheduledFireTime()
OperableTrigger
getTrigger()
boolean
isRecovering()
-
-
-
Constructor Detail
-
TriggerFiredBundle
public TriggerFiredBundle(JobDetail job, OperableTrigger trigger, Calendar cal, boolean jobIsRecovering, java.util.Date fireTime, java.util.Date scheduledFireTime, java.util.Date prevFireTime, java.util.Date nextFireTime)
-
-
Method Detail
-
getJobDetail
public JobDetail getJobDetail()
-
getTrigger
public OperableTrigger getTrigger()
-
getCalendar
public Calendar getCalendar()
-
isRecovering
public boolean isRecovering()
-
getFireTime
public java.util.Date getFireTime()
- Returns:
- Returns the fireTime.
-
getNextFireTime
public java.util.Date getNextFireTime()
- Returns:
- Returns the nextFireTime.
-
getPrevFireTime
public java.util.Date getPrevFireTime()
- Returns:
- Returns the prevFireTime.
-
getScheduledFireTime
public java.util.Date getScheduledFireTime()
- Returns:
- Returns the scheduledFireTime.
-
-